Home Ministry reissues instruction making masks compulsory



KATHMANDU: The Home Ministry has re-issued an instruction to all administration offices of the 77 districts in the country to take action against people leaving their houses without wearing masks.

According to Uma Kanta Adhikari, the Communication Officer with the Ministry, the instruction has been issued as people are seen wandering around without wearing masks despite high risk of coronavirus spread.

Adhikari said that people defying the Ministry’s instruction will be punished as per the Infectious Disease Act 1964.

It should be noted that the Home Ministry had on July 6 issued an instruction to the Nepal Police headquarters to arrest people going out of the house without wearing masks.
